
The AirTAC Airtac SGCD Dual Rod Cylinder SGCD250X80S is a genuine double acting, double rod ISO 15552 (orig. ISO 6431) tie-rod air cylinder with a Ø250mm bore and 80mm stroke, G1 air ports and adjustable end cushioning. Its large-bore tie-rod build delivers high thrust and drops into standardized ISO 15552 mounting on heavy automation.
Delivering 23562 N of equal thrust in both directions at 0.5 MPa, this large-bore ISO 15552 tie-rod cylinder uses a twin-rod piston to balance your load path perfectly. A rod exits each cover, meaning the effective area is identical on extension and retraction. The four steel tie rods clamp the aluminum barrel securely, and the bore features a G1 air port with an M42x2.0 rod thread.
Because the piston carries a magnet, this -S SKU supports CMSG, DMSG, and EMSG switches for position sensing. Note that TPU seals are not offered on this 250 mm bore; it uses NBR packings, with a Viton H option available for 0 to 150 degree Celsius environments. The 60 mm adjustable air cushions at both ends absorb heavy kinetic energy, yielding a safe working load of roughly 14137 N or a 1201 kg vertical lift with a 2:1 margin.

Double-rod: the rod passes through both covers, so output force is equal in both directions.

As the largest bore in the range, the 250 mm sits at the high edge above the 200 mm option (which provides 15079 N both ways at 0.5 MPa). Choose this double-rod design when you need strict anti-rotation resistance, symmetric load distribution, or a rear rod to drive a secondary tool or sensor cam. It supports FA, LB, TC, FTC, TCM1, and TCM2 mounts per the ISO 15552 mounting interface. Even at 80 mm stroke, verify your external guide rails to prevent side-load damage, and remember a plain cylinder drifts on air loss—use an external rod lock for holding.

No, the air cushions only decelerate the piston near the stroke ends and do not act as a brake. If power fails, the load will drift. You must install an external rod lock or a pilot-operated check valve to hold a suspended load safely.
